    重型H型钢拉伸性能异常原因

    Reasons for abnormal tensile properties of heavy type H-beam

    • 摘要: 针对重型H型钢在纵向拉伸和Z向拉伸试验中塑性低和断口出现银白色斑点等异常现象,采用宏观观察、化学成分分析、金相检验、断口分析以及去氢退火试验等方法,对造成上述异常现象的原因进行了分析。结果表明:试样断口表面上存在的银白色斑点是氢不断地向试样材料缺陷处(氢陷阱)聚集而形成的“白点”。去氢退火可以有效地使恢复材料的塑性。

       

      Abstract: In view of the abnormal phenomena such as low plasticity and silvery white spots on the fracture of heavy type H-beam in longitudinal and Z-direction tensile tests. The causes of the above anomalies were analyzed by means of macroscopic observation, chemical composition analysis, metallographic testing, fracture analysis and dehydrogenation annealing test. The results show that the silvery white spots on the fracture surface of the sample were white spots formed by the continuous accumulation of hydrogen to the defects (hydrogen traps). Dehydrogenation annealing could effectively restore the plasticity of the material.
